Plugin authors targeting the Glimmerbox rendering SDK should be aware of a known memory leak in the ThumbCache layer: decoded bitmaps are retained when a plugin unregisters without calling releaseSurface(). Until patch 4.2.3 lands, always invoke cache.evictAll() in your teardown hook, and avoid holding direct references to CachedImage handles across reload cycles. To verify eviction metrics, query the internal Cachewatch telemetry endpoint, which authenticates with the key shown below.

app token of kajop-tahag = qvz23-qaEp6MzrfP2AwhVbZwsZeUq

## Formula sandbox tuning

User-supplied formulas in Gridmoor execute inside a restricted interpreter with hard ceilings on time, memory, and call depth. Reviewers should confirm any change to these ceilings is justified in the PR description, since raising them widens the abuse surface. Defaults were chosen from production traces. The current limits are as follows.

limits module of tafog-fawip:
WEIGHTS = {
    "julix": 57,
    "lamys": 992,
    "kasvan": 209,
    "quenok": 750,
    "alddor": 259,
    "oliath": 1009,
    "wenix": 815,
}

## Deployment

The `pixelscythe` CLI handles batch image resizing for the Dunmore asset pipeline. Release builds must be cut from a tagged commit, and the binary is published to the internal artifact store only after the smoke suite passes on the staging worker pool. Before promoting a release, confirm the worker configuration matches the target environment. The expected values are listed below.

service settings:
[casax]
port = 6379
team = rusir
host = casax.zemvarhq.corp
region = outer-4
access_code = ac_9808ce
timeout_ms = 1500

## Dedupe Runbook

Customer dedupe runs nightly via the MergeWright job. Candidate pairs land in `dedupe_candidates`; confirmed merges move to `merge_log`. If the job stalls, check for lock contention on `customer_master` first. Do not rerun mid-merge. To inspect stuck candidates directly, use the connection string below.

replica DSN, yahaf-yagaf: mongodb://tamath_svc:a2netSk3RZMuTj@db-d084.novacsoft.internal:5432/ralmir